Extremely safe: Barrier opening does not drop below the bed base. Simple, silent barrier system. Plexiglas to make the child visible. The edge prevents falls, even with the barrier lowered.
Safe: Sliding barrier with silent and automatic locking inaccessible to the child. Bars 5.5 cm apart. Flat, non-flexible bars. Hygienic: Slatted bed base that allows the mattress to breathe. Sturdy: In high-quality varnished solid beech. Practical: easy to open with one hand. Moves easily and quietly. Quick to assemble.
From eco-managed forests
Complies with standard EN 716-1, 2
Technical data
Dimensions
L: 125 cm - W: 65.5 cm - H: 150 cm. H. barrier down (relative to the ground): 112.25 cm. Weight: 43 kg.
Made from
SOLID BEECH (structure) and MELAMINE COATED CHIPBOARD (panels).
Fitted with
Supplied with 4 wheels and brake.
Delivery
Delivered without mattress. Delivered flat-packed, do-it-yourself installation.
Tips for using
For use with a 120 x 60 cm mattress.
Other
Fitted with two slatted bases and a sliding barrier.
Additional infos
Caution: bed bases in the high position should only be used for children who are not yet sitting.
The bars of all Wesco wooden cots have been oblong in shape since 2012. In other words they are flat with rounded edges. This design ensures that the cot bars are close together providing a much higher level of safety. Tests carried out on our wooden beds show that the base is 6 times stronger than the required standard.
